Bethel School District (Washington)

403 is a public school district in Pierce County, Washington, USA and serves 200 square miles (520 km2) of unincorporated Pierce County including Spanaway, Graham, Kapowsin and the city of Roy.

[3] The superintendent is Brian Lowney, who became the district's leader in 2024.

The district includes: Elk Plain, Roy, South Creek, Spanaway.

It also includes the majority of the following: Frederickson, Graham, and Kapowsin.

Additionally, it has portions of Clover Creek, Fort Lewis, McChord Field, Parkland, South Hill, and Summit View.
